Engine Installation (Fig. 5)
1. Position machine on a level surface. Make sure that
spark plug wire is not connected to engine spark plug.
2. Make sure that all parts removed from the engine
during maintenance or rebuilding are properly installed
to the engine.

3. If engine coupler (item 3) was removed from engine
output shaft, install coupler.
A. Position square key in output shaft keyway. Apply
antiseize lubricant to top surface of key.
B. Slide coupler onto output shaft until it contacts
shoulder on shaft.
C. Secure coupler to output shaft with two (2) set
screws (item 14). Torque set screws 65 in−lb (7.3
N−m).
